Mitsubishi WD-60638 1080p 3D-Ready DLP HDTV

Before buying 3D TVs, it is essential to read ahead of time 3D TV reviews to educate yourself on their specifications and features. The 60-inch Mitsubishi WD-60638 1080p HDTV offers users with cheapest and inexpensive ways of experiencing 3D viewing. It has DLP technology features showcasing a thousand times quicker than the LCD technology capable of providing a realistic, crisper 2D as well as 3D viewing. Because of its 3D ready viewing technology, you can possibly get the best option of 3D content at your very own home.

It also includes a 6 color processor offering a brighter, sharp, vivid and realistic color producing wider range of colors, blacker blacks and whiter whites. It also includes a 120Hz sub frame rate that ensures picture display to be free from blurs especially in fast motion movies and sports. There are also other features integrated including the HDMI ports and the stereo speakers having 20 watts total power.

Features:

• It has 60 inch DLP HDTV offering intensely clear 2D and completely immersive 3D viewing.
• You will be able to enjoy lifelike viewing because it delivers incredible performance on pictures at really excellent value.
• The 120 Hz Sub-Frame Rate reduces blur during quick motions and the stereo speakers.
• It measures in 53.9 x 36.7 and 15.1 inches (stand included)
• It has 3 HDMI, 2 composite, 2 component, 1 optical digital audio output and 1 USB.

It is way better than other models in its price range size and quality wise. To be informed on the quality and price rate of these TVs, you should always make it a point to read 3D TV reviews. This works well with shaded daylight that falls into the screen. Compared to LCD, this model is about 16 inches thick with a projector bulb that can be replaced in its useful life. Despite the many attributes, users can also expect for the downside of this product considering the affordability of the price. It does not have the complex selective contrast enhancing features that are present in new LED LCD TVs.

It also does not have analog outputs which mean that if you wish to add external audio system, it must include digital SP/DIF coax and input stereo to eliminate possibilities of lip sync.

There are also no networking and internet support included. A PC has to be included to the AV system if you wish to watch downloaded videos. Since the PC oriented video inputs are actually HDMI, there is no place to plug traditional 15 pin analog CRT connector.

Despite its imperfections and the rest of the important features that are not included, you will still encounter a fresher and great 3D viewing experience. Its overall integrated features make it appear to be one great HDTV especially when you know that you can spend lesser when you purchase this product. 3D TV reviews like this will help you define the quality and affordability the product offers.

Things to Watch Out For When Buying Cheap Hitachi Projector Lamps

!±8± Things to Watch Out For When Buying Cheap Hitachi Projector Lamps

It is usually recommended that manufacturer's originals, rather than unbranded copies, are used when replacing Hitachi projector lamps. Poorly produced alternatives are often short-lived, thus negating any savings you've made. Worse still, they can be dangerous.

Hitachi projector lamps are subject to very high levels of quality control. This is essential when you consider how projector lamps are made. The bulb contains mercury vapour, which is contained under pressure. Imagine the prospects if this glass suddenly exploded, releasing its contents into the air (or worse still, into the face of the person using it); Hitachi projector lamps have a lifetime guarantee against such things happening.

Projectors can be expensive to repair when they go wrong; luckily, replacing the lamp is one of the few maintenance projects users can undertake themselves.

You should remember that a projector lamp is far more than just a bulb. Hitachi projector bulbs are sold as a unit which comprises several elements. These include an ARC tube containing highly pressurised mercury vapour; a quartz reflector, fittings and wiring and the external housing. This is only a very simple outline; the current that activates the mercury vapour, for example, is regulated by electrical ballasts, which supply exactly the right voltage to ignite and sustain the bulb's output while in use.

Original components are made of top quality materials and manufactured to exacting standards. The reflector, for example, is a hard quartz globe lined with highly reflective material. To hold the ARC tube in place, the base is filled with extra-strength caulking material. The mercury vapour in the arc tube is compressed at ultra-high pressure to exactly the right level. All this means expensive technology and a team of expert engineers and scientists, whose role is to ensure the mercury vapour will ignite correctly, and that the tubes, reflectors and wiring assembly are structurally sound.

Hitachi projector lamps vary in their output of lumens. This means machinery must be recalibrated for each specific model - precise calibration is essential. The highly specialised nature of manufacturing and the cost of the production machinery and materials, means there are very few manufacturers of high-quality Hitachi projector lamps in the world.

However, this does not mean you are stuck with buying a "manufacturer's own" labelled product. There are online companies selling both manufacturers' originals and alternative lamps for the same projector models. The bulbs and other working parts can be manufactured to the same quality standards as the originals. In fact, in many cases the bulb is the same - it's simply the housing, packaging and non-working hardware that are different. "Unbranded" bulbs are often made by known professional lighting manufacturers such as Phillips or Osram.

Provided you go to a trusted and reputable retailer, it is possible to buy copycat Hitachi projector lamps which are every bit as good as the manufacturer's original. Those worried about invalidating their projector's warranty can rest assured that neither copyright nor warranty is affected in any way.
